What comprises an actual electrical emergency

Not every stumbled breaker warrants an after hours call. Some circumstances, however, are instant risks. If you are not sure, err on safety and security, but it aids to know the difference.

Water and power with each other relocate an issue to the front of the line. If a tornado has actually driven water into your panel, a pipeline burst over a light, or you see arcing at an exterior solution pole where the utility lines attach, treat it as immediate. Any kind of odor of warm insulation near a panel, switch, or receptacle is entitled to interest now, not tomorrow. So do duplicated breaker trips tied to heat generating lots, like area heaters, dryers, stoves, or EV chargers. Those are precisely the circuits that expose weak connections.

On the commercial side, a whole panel dark because of a failed major, a stumbled shunt journey linked to an emergency alarm, or an item of important devices down with signs of a fault will usually justify a send off. Dining establishments and cold store centers usually can not wait. If power loss threats food safety, life safety, or considerable business losses, that becomes an actual emergency.

Some points can wait if you can separate them securely. A single dead outlet in a bed room that functions once again after a reset can obtain scheduled. A GFCI that journeys when the exterior vacation lights splash can be unplugged for the night. The line is safety. If you can restore security by disconnecting, shutting off, or separating a circuit without touching something that shows up harmed, you likely can sleep on it. If not, call.

What a reputable 24/7 solution actually looks like

The best electric business do not merely respond to a phone after hours. They run systems that make a late evening work secure, traceable, and efficient. Anticipate a live dispatcher or a standing by electrical contractor to answer without delay, verify your location, confirm your callback number in case you obtain separated, and ask targeted questions. They will wish to know if you scent shedding, see smoke, listen to buzzing, or have water intruding. They must tell you clearly what to switch off, and when to leave the building.

A major company sends out a stocked solution lorry, not a technology in an automobile with a screwdriver. In technique that implies common breakers from the regional panel brand names, a variety of cord evaluates and adapters, GFCI and AFCI gadgets, meter bases and lugs, a few contactors and relays for standard HVAC emergencies, and lockout gadgets. Advanced stores also carry a thermal cam, a non call voltage tester, a clamp meter that can review inrush existing, and a megohmmeter to examine insulation failure. These tools cut diagnosis time in half.

One silent however important indicator of professionalism and trust is paperwork. You ought to exist with a clear price sheet or at least a priced estimate after hours analysis charge prior to the vehicle rolls. On website, the electrical expert should describe findings in plain language, write down the immediate fix and any kind of recommended adhere to ups, and give pictures if they opened anything considerable. If a momentary fixing is made, it must be classified thus, with a strategy to return if allowing or components are required.

What you can securely do while you wait

When early steps are clear and easy, a little activity can minimize damages and danger prior to the electrical expert arrives.

  • If you scent shedding near a gadget or panel and it is secure to method, turn off the associated breaker. If you can not determine it or the panel itself smells hot, tip away and turn off the primary. Do closed a cigarette smoking panel.
  • If water is entering components or a panel, shut down water upstream if you can do so without stepping into water. Maintain individuals clear. If water has actually gotten to electrical outlets or cords, stay clear of the area.
  • Unplug warm creating devices like space heating units, toaster ovens, and irons from suspicious circuits. Do not count just on changed power strips.
  • If a person gets a shock and is still in contact, do not touch them. Turn off power at the primary or relocate the resource away with a completely dry, nonconductive things like a wood broom manage. Call emergency clinical services.
  • Keep children and pet dogs far from the afflicted area. Switch on additional lights somewhere else so you are stagnating in the dark.

The anatomy of an after hours service call

Knowing how a night call commonly unravels gets rid of a few of the anxiousness. A trained emergency electrician will start with a visual and sensory evaluation. That means smelling for overheated insulation, listening for humming, and seeking staining on gadgets, cable ends, and breaker faces. They will ask you to recreate the trouble if it is safe to do so. When a journey is repeatable, medical diagnosis speeds up dramatically.

Next comes screening. Non call voltage testers determine live conductors securely. A clamp meter determines lots on suspect circuits and can show if a motor is electrical companies electricians attracting locked rotor current. If a ground mistake is thought, testing at the GFCI or with an insulation resistance meter can divide a bad appliance from a wiring issue. Thermal imaging grabs loose lugs, overheated breakers, and endangered bus bars that do not look wrong to the eye yet.

Decisions come under three containers. Safe and restore currently. Make safe, then arrange a full repair service with components or an authorization. Or isolate and end until a bigger fix can be intended. A failed primary breaker, for example, could be changed that evening if the exact suit gets on the truck and the utility does not need to pull the meter. If the meter has to be drawn or the service pole has been damaged by a dropped branch, the electrician may collaborate with the utility and building department for a short-term disconnect and a same day or following day permanent repair work. Good firms recognize who to call after hours.

I remember a Saturday where a hot water heater with a failing aspect tripped a dual pole breaker whenever it attempted to recuperate. We drew the separate at the heater, meggered the components to validate insulation breakdown, and restored the remainder of the house safely. A brand-new element and gasket went in on Monday. The client invested 2 days without hot water, yet the home was or else typical and, crucially, risk-free. Contrast that with a small pastry shop where a corroded lug at the main started arcing. That a person needed an energy pull, a brand-new major breaker, and a reterminated solution conductor. We were back up by 9 a.m., saving a day's well worth of dough.

Common wrongdoers at strange hours, and what repairs actually look like

Heating period brings room heater overloads. Those little boxes attract 12 to 13 amps, and many older rooms share a 15 amp circuit across numerous outlets. Include a phone battery charger, a TELEVISION, and a fish tank heater, and the breaker does what it should. The actual threat is expansion cords and power strips that are not rated for continuous high tons. A trustworthy electrical expert will certainly typically advise a committed 20 amp circuit with a larger scale go to the primary heating system area, along with meddle immune receptacles and appropriate cord management. It is a clean job that avoids repeat calls.

Older homes with aluminum branch circuits see issues after years of thermal cycling. Loose terminations at receptacles and changes warm up, and you smell that unique fishy odor from melting insulation. In the short-term, a pro can replace the worst devices and use ports ranked for aluminum to copper shifts. As a longer strategy, pigtailing with accepted adapters or a targeted rewiring of high tons circuits decreases threat. That discussion is best had in daytime, yet the emergency electrician should be able to make the immediate places secure that night.

On the commercial side, rooftop devices that fail on cool mornings typically indicate contactors with matched factors or crankcase heating units that have actually fallen short. A prepared technology can exchange a contactor, check stage equilibrium, and get heat back without calling a separate cooling and heating service provider. Coordination issues right here. Excellent electrical business preserve connections with mechanical companies so you are not stuck while 2 professions suggest about scope.

Storms develop their very own account of damages. A tree limb draws a service decrease, splitting the meter base. The power firm will tell you they can not bring back power till an accredited electrician fixings the consumer possessed components. That is the moment you value a 24/7 store that maintains meter bases, avenue, and weatherheads in supply and recognizes your energy's evaluation procedure. The ideal electrical contractor can install a brand-new base, established the mast, protected guying if required, and collaborate a re-energize the same day.

Pricing that makes good sense, and what a reasonable billing looks like

After hours function costs a lot more. That component is simple. How business structure it varies, and it aids to recognize the usual models so you can identify the sensible middle.

Most legitimate stores charge a send off or diagnostic charge that covers the initial block of time, typically 60 to 90 mins. After that, they bill by the hour, usually at a higher multiple than daytime rates. A 1.5 x to 2x multiplier is normal after twelve o'clock at night or on vacations. Materials are billed at retail or cost plus a standard margin, which covers equipping, bring, and warranty management. You should see line things for components and labor, not simply a lump sum, unless the firm utilizes flat rate pricing with codes that represent a composed publication. Both strategies can be fair.

Beware of fuzzy quotes like we will certainly see what it looks like when we arrive with no reference of base charges. Additionally be wary of high-pressure salesmanship tactics to update panels or re-wire the whole home on the spot because of one overheating receptacle. There are times when a panel is truly endangered and needs replacement soon. A specialist electrical contractor can speak you via the proof, reveal thermal images or harmed bus bars, and suggest a momentary procedure if secure to do so.

Warranty policies must be specified. Several business use 1 year labor service warranty and go through the manufacturer's service warranty on parts. Emergency job that is short-lived should be identified by doing this. If a breaker is replaced to get you with the night, but the panel needs assessment, that note belongs on the invoice. It shields you and makes clear expectations.

Safety pens you need to see on site

Watch just how the electrician approaches your equipment. Prior to any kind of cover comes off, you need to see them evaluate their meter on a known real-time resource, after that on the circuit, after that back on the recognized resource again. That basic three step confirms the tester and is a routine of pros. Handwear covers, safety glasses, and insulated electrical companies services tools are not overkill in a limited panel. If they are operating in damp conditions, GFCI protected momentary power needs to be utilized. Ladder positioning, panel cover handling, and tidy workspace are little informs that include up.

Lockout tagout is not just for factories. If power is being turned off to do job, there should be a noticeable technique to stop accidental re energizing, also if that is as simple as a lock on the detach and a tag mentioning who is working and just how to reach them. In homes, communication can replace when only one person exists, but in multi household or business settings, an official lockout is essential.

When you ought to call the utility first

Not all interruptions get on your side of the meter. If your entire neighborhood is dark, call the utility failure line and report it. If you see arcing at the service drop before it reaches your weatherhead, or an arm or leg has actually taken down lines in the road, the energy is the initial call. If the meter itself is cracked or water filled up, several energies require that they eliminate and reinstall it. Your electrician will certainly collaborate with them, yet you can start the procedure much faster by opening up a ticket.

Power flickers across the entire home, lights lighten up and dim, or you measure uncommonly high voltage on both legs feeding your panel, those are signs and symptoms of a loosened neutral on the utility side. That is an utility emergency situation. Do not neglect it; loosened neutrals can cook electronics and trigger motor failings quickly.

Building a reasonable plan for following time

It appears odd to plan for emergency situations, however a couple of easy actions reduced tension and price. Map your panel and tag circuits with something much more honest than cooking area. If two breakers feed the kitchen, claim which one runs the outlets by the toaster and which feed the dishwasher. Set Up GFCIs and AFCIs where code and common sense need them. They are not ideal, yet they reduce injury and fire risk measurably.

If you have recurring overloads, do not rely upon frequent resets. A breaker that trips often is doing its task and telling you the electrical wiring or tons pattern is wrong. Ask an electrician to include a specialized circuit or redistribute lots. For services, recognize crucial circuits and consider surge protection at the solution and at sensitive devices. Maintain spares of unique integrates on website if your center still utilizes merged disconnects for older equipment.

Finally, build a short vetted list of emergency get in touches with. 2 electrical firms, your utility's emergency situation number, and, if relevant, your smoke alarm and elevator solution suppliers. Shop it where anybody can find it. When stimulates fly, you do not wish to be scrolling via search results, guessing.
